CHEER Hospital of the Week: Southwest Mississippi Regional Medical Center!

1/27/2020

Comments

 
PictureSOUTHWEST MISSISSIPPI REGIONAL MEDICAL CENTER
Congratulations to Southwest Mississippi Regional Medical Center (SMRMC) on their Baby-Friendly designation! This accomplishment was announced on December 12, 2019, approximately 3 years after they joined the pathway to designation in 2016. Located in McComb MS, SMRMC oversees a Level II NICU and about 813 births per year.

“To be Baby-Friendly is extremely rewarding!  Labor and Delivery (L&D) has completely been transformed in the way we practice maternity and infant care, providing a “Family Centered” environment for the mother and baby couplets that deliver on our unit,” states Angela Ferguson-Parker, CLC, and Lactation Team Lead.
​
When asked about the challenges faced and victories accomplished throughout the process, Angela shared that the culture, work flow, and logistical changes required for their facility to achieve designation was no easy task. She further mentioned that while the slow progression in their data made it tough to remain motivated sometimes, it mostly pushed them to work even harder towards the goal of designation. Angela is proud that they are the 18th hospital in MS and amongst the first 600 hospitals in the U.S. to be Baby-Friendly designated. She is happy that the team faced little to no resistance from moms to the new changes, which made the process easier. She also noted that the increase in staff knowledge about breastfeeding and their desire to assist moms through challenges was a high point. 

Picture
A portion of SMRMC’s BFHI Multidisciplinary Task Force including Administration, LDRP, Accounting, Gyn/Peds, Purchasing, Education
Since joining the pathway in 2016, the staff approach to providing maternity services has changed. According to Angela, every staff personnel is providing evidence-based education to every mother about the benefits of breastfeeding, risks of formula feeding, the importance of skin to skin and rooming in, and the proper preparation and handling of breastmilk substitutes. They also provide resources for post-discharge assistance and follow up. “All patients are now well-informed and supported to make decisions as to how they choose to feed and care for their babies,” Angela reports.

SMRMC first celebrated their achievement on December 30th. Going forward, they intend to stay up to date on trainings and updated materials to best serve and educate their patients, and take steps to increase the exclusive breastfeeding rates. They will promote, protect, and support breastfeeding while working hard to implement the Ten Steps to successful breastfeeding and uphold the International Code of Marketing of Breast-milk Substitutes.
